'Second Name' is a standout track from Hop Along's 2018 album, 'Bark Your Head Off, Dog'. The band, known for their unique blend of indie rock and folk influences, has been steadily gaining attention since their formation in 2008. 'Bark Your Head Off, Dog' marked a significant evolution in their sound, showcasing more intricate arrangements and lyrical depth. The album received widespread acclaim, positioning Hop Along as one of the most innovative bands in the contemporary indie scene.
